- > Is there a VMS Version of either lex or flex and where can I get it?
-
- Flex has been ported to VMS and the regular source distribution
- supports it (including a makefile for use with MMS). I vaguely recall
- needing to make a couple of minor changes in order to build it (that
- was a year or two ago).
-
- VMS POSIX and the old DEC/Shell product both contain lex (and
- also yacc).
